Primary Location: UK - London - Aldgate Tower
Job Description
Join our dynamic and multidisciplinary team working with Data Centre clients across both Hyperscale and Colocation and also Enterprise on projects across the UK, Europe and globally.
We are seeking a senior leader with a strong technical background in the Data Centre sector to act as Delivery Lead at Director level, combining client leadership, large‑scale team leadership and multi‑regional delivery accountability.
In this role, you will have overall responsibility for the design leadership and delivery of multiple Data Centre programmes, ensuring consistently high standards of technical quality, commercial performance and client satisfaction across a global portfolio.
You’ll drive technical excellence, manage delivery teams, and ensure projects are completed on time, on budget, and to the highest standard.
You’ll have the platform to influence, lead and shape the future of AECOM’s data centre delivery capability at a senior level.
The location of the role is flexible within the UK / Ireland; however it important that it is local to one of our hubs of expertise – London, Dublin, Manchester and the role will require travel within the UK &I and Europe.
Ideally you will live locally to an office or be willing to relocate.
What you’ll do
* Lead and manage the UK & Ireland Data Centre delivery organisation, providing leadership, direction and development for a team of 100+ professionals across architectural, engineering and specialist disciplines
* Accountable for the end‑to‑end design process and delivery of multiple Data Centre projects for key clients across the UK, Europe and globally, from early concept through detailed design and construction support
* Lead a portfolio of data centre projects from a delivery, technical and commercial standpoint
* Act as the senior delivery and escalation lead for high‑profile Data Centre clients, maintaining trusted, long‑term relationships at executive and director level
* Provide overall technical, commercial and operational leadership across a portfolio of programmes, ensuring projects are delivered safely, on time, on budget and to the highest quality standards
* Coordinate bids and supplier requests, ensuring seamless collaboration across disciplines
* Chair strategic meetings, lead financial reviews, and report key metrics to senior leadership
* Ensure consistency and quality across all deliverables, managing resource allocation and resolving technical issues proactively
Who We’re Looking For
* A Chartered Engineer or equivalent with a strong technical background in the data centre sector
* Proven experience leading large, multi‑disciplinary delivery teams and complex Data Centre programmes
* A confident communicator and relationship builder who can lead client interactions at director level
* Commercially savvy with experience managing risk, governance, and profitability
* Willing to travel across UK&I and Europe as required
Qualifications
* In‑depth understanding of building systems, regulations, contracts, and construction types
* Familiarity with Revit, Microsoft Office, and collaborative digital platforms
* Strong knowledge of design workflows and managing fast‑paced project environments
* A valid driving licence and proven ability to manage competing priorities
We are a Disability Confident Employer and will offer an interview to applicants who have a disability or long‑term condition, who meet the minimum/essential criteria for the role. Please let us know using the email address ReasonableAccommodationsUKI@aecom.com if you would like to apply through the Disability Confident Interview Scheme.
All your information will be kept confidential according to EEO guidelines.
#J-18808-Ljbffr